History

Luo Can founded the Fate Defying Pavilion after recounting how he had risen from 0.5 innate soul power and a supposedly “trash” White Silkworm Martial Soul to become a Title Douluo. He invited those willing to pursue strength and change their destinies to join him, framing the pavilion’s name as a declaration that one’s fate belongs in one’s own hands. 34

The organization developed around Baican Village and Fate Defying Valley. Qian Renxue was appointed Vice Pavilion Master, giving the young faction a second central leader, while Ye Qingyu took responsibility for its daily management. 36 68 Its early membership included disciples selected for their potential and temperament rather than elite backgrounds; Luo Can promised to improve their aptitude through marrow cleansing but emphasized that their ultimate growth would depend on their own efforts. 24

The pavilion expanded from a cultivation faction into a multi-hall organization. Its Medicine Hall refined and distributed medicinal products, its Soul Tool Hall developed and manufactured Soul Tools, and the Defense Clan later established the Defense Hall after joining the organization. 68 207 258 264

Its intervention in the Clear Sky Sect’s siege of the Breaking and Defense Clans became a major public demonstration of strength. Cheng Gang and Ling Yuan defeated the Clear Sky Sect’s Fourth and Fifth Elders, while the pavilion’s Level 9 Soul Tools helped force Tang Hao’s retreat. 251 252 Niu Gao subsequently joined as Defense Hall Master, and the pavilion’s reputation spread among major factions. 258 264

Following its public rise, the pavilion deepened its alliance with the Seven Treasure Glazed Tile Sect. The sect sent ten disciples to learn Soul Tool techniques at the pavilion, while the Soul Tool Hall pursued standardized equipment, Soul Tool Mechas, and improved Battle Armor-forging methods. 303 319

Luo Can subsequently brought the Shui Clan into the pavilion by offering cultivation resources, Contribution Point rewards, and the prospect of Martial Soul Evolution. The clan’s water-attribute Spirit Masters expanded the organization’s pill-refining potential, while Shui Bing’er became Luo Can’s disciple and Shui Yue’er joined her sister. 324 327

The pavilion’s industrial influence continued to grow after Saint Craftsman Mu Chen agreed to assist Ju Zi, Xuan Ziwen, and Lou Gao with Battle Armor forging. Its auction of Thousand-Forged Tungsten Steel in Heaven Dou City served as a public recruitment signal for blacksmiths across the continent; the metal ultimately sold for one million Gold Soul Coins, and numerous blacksmiths began returning to the pavilion. 339 344 355

Disciple System

The pavilion accepts disciples under twenty and prioritizes resilient character and diligence over exceptional innate talent. Its leadership considers resources plentiful, but trustworthy and hardworking people scarce. 191

  • Outer Pavilion Disciples — General members who cultivate, perform tasks, and earn Contribution Points. 36 214
  • Inner Pavilion Disciples — Members who pass the Temperament Test, Combat Test, and Teamwork assessment within the Trial Tower. 206
  • Core DisciplesLuo Can’s personally trained disciples, who receive intensive cultivation guidance and specialized training. 214 265
  • Guest Elders — High-level recruits who receive elder treatment while serving under negotiated conditions, including Du Bisi and Ye Guyi. 184 297

Assessment and Rewards

The Trial Tower is a seven-story Soul Tool facility used for assessments and combat training. Its illusory realms, mechanisms, and Spirit Beast Phantoms test combat ability, adaptability, temperament, and teamwork. 206

Assessment Stage Requirement
Temperament Test Resist temptations, fears, and pressure within an illusory realm. 206
Combat Test Defeat same-rank Spirit Beast Phantoms; scoring considers victories, time, and injuries. 206
Teamwork Complete a three-person assigned task while demonstrating coordination, command, and adaptability. 206
  • Inner Pavilion rankings award Contribution Points, Black-grade Soul Power Pills, and Ten-Thousand Year Whale Rubber monthly. 206
  • Maintaining a top-ten ranking can eventually earn Soul Bones ranging from ten-thousand-year to hundred-thousand-year quality. 206
  • The annual All-Pavilion Grand Competition is open to Outer and Inner Pavilion disciples; its top three receive a month of cultivation in the Fate Defying Secret Realm, alongside pills and Soul Tools. 216 225
  • The upcoming Grand Competition is restricted to participants below thirty years old, reinforcing the pavilion’s focus on cultivating younger generations. 355

Facilities and Operations

  • Fate Defying Valley / Fate Defying Secret Realm — The pavilion’s hidden cultivation sanctuary. After its transformation into a Small World, it possesses enhanced energy and life force; cultivation there is described as over ten times faster than outside. 214 216
  • Spatial Barrier — A protective trait surrounding the valley that blocks external detection and intrusion. 44
  • Medicine Hall — Produces medicines and supports the pavilion’s pharmaceutical operations. It is preparing additional branches in cities associated with the Four Element Academies. 175 207 355
  • Soul Tool Hall — Develops Soul Tools, Battle Armor, Soul Tool Mechas, and production methods under Ju Zi, Xuan Ziwen, Lou Gao, and Mu Chen. 68 319 339
  • Defense Hall — The Defense Clan’s hall, responsible for construction and defensive projects. 258 264
  • Mission Hall — Issues missions for Contribution Points, including exploration of unknown regions and live capture of soul beasts for valley domestication. 184 190
  • Trial Tower — A Soul Tool assessment and training structure capable of use through the Spirit Saint level. 206
  • Grand Competition Arena — A Soul Tool arena built to withstand full-force Spirit Emperor combat. 276
  • Suotuo Intermediate Soul Master Academy — An intermediate academy established opposite Shrek Academy, serving as a base for pavilion disciples training at the Suotuo City Great Soul Arena and competing for talent. 327
  • Heaven Dou Advanced Soul Master Academy — An advanced academy in Heaven Dou City overseen by Dugu Bo and intended to prepare students for the All-Continent Advanced Soul Master Academy Elite Tournament. 327

Resources and Technology

  • Medicinal products — The pavilion markets products including Injury Recovery Pills and Spirit Recovery Liquid through Luo’s Herb Shop network. 178 191
  • Soul Tools — Its shops sell daily-use Soul Tools, while its combat equipment includes offensive and defensive tools powerful enough to influence battles between high-level Spirit Masters. 248 252
  • Soul Tool Mecha — The first-generation Soul Tool Mecha was tested by Ye Lingling and Dugu Yan in Fate Defying Valley. The Soul Tool Hall later advances the Fire Starter Mark I Mecha toward production. 154 319
  • Battle Armor research — The Soul Tool Hall develops Battle Armor technology, including the Firefly Battle Armor project. Xuan Ziwen, Lou Gao, and Mu Chen later advance its forging theory and work toward Spirit-Forged Metal. 103 303 339
  • Artificial Spirit Ring and Soul Spirit technologyLuo Can possesses mature technical Crystal Cores for both fields, potentially allowing Spirit Masters to obtain rings without hunting spirit beasts. The technology remains confidential while the pavilion works toward mass-producing Spirit Rings below ten thousand years. 297 304
  • Grand Medicine Garden — A specially modified garden using spirit-gathering and environmental-simulation arrays to cultivate high-potency herbs year-round. 281
  • Rare metals — The Soul Tool Hall possesses extensive stores of rare metals, including Blue Nurturing Copper and Magic Silver, obtained through Luo Can’s Fishing System. 319
  • Thousand-Forged Tungsten Steel — A high-grade forging product created through the Soul Tool Hall’s collaboration. Its public auction sold for one million Gold Soul Coins and was used to attract blacksmiths from across the continent. 344 355

Story Role / Major Arcs

Founding and Early Recruitment

The pavilion is created as Luo Can’s answer to the fate imposed on him by his weak beginnings. Its initial recruitment establishes the organization’s central promise: resources and opportunity for those willing to work for strength. 24 34

Institutional Expansion

With Qian Renxue and Ye Qingyu handling leadership and administration, the pavilion develops disciple trials, Contribution Point rewards, a Mission Hall, and specialized halls for medicine and Soul Tools. 68 184 206

Four Single-Attribute Clans Conflict

The pavilion refuses to rely on the Seven Treasure Glazed Tile Sect during the Clear Sky Sect’s siege of Yang Wudi and Niu Gao. By deploying Cheng Gang and Ling Yuan instead, it publicly establishes that it can defend its own members and interests. 247 251 252

Rise as a Continental Power

The organization’s expanding herb shops, Soul Tool stores, advanced equipment, and growing number of experts draw the attention of the Seven Treasure Glazed Tile Sect and Spirit Hall. Spirit Hall ultimately judges that becoming enemies with the pavilion would be too costly. 248 257

Small World and Elite Force Plan

After Fate Defying Valley becomes a Small World, the pavilion begins gathering orphans aged six to ten for a secret elite force raised within the hidden realm. 215 216

Grand Competition

The inaugural Grand Competition showcases the pavilion’s practical combat philosophy, disciple quality, and Soul Tool technology to allied observers from the Seven Treasure Glazed Tile Sect. 282 283 293

Shui Clan Recruitment and Academy Expansion

Luo Can recruits the Shui Clan by leveraging the pavilion’s resources and its promise of Martial Soul Evolution. The organization subsequently establishes academies in Suotuo City and Heaven Dou City to cultivate talent, compete for students, and prepare for future continental academy competitions. 324 327

Forging and Blacksmith Recruitment

The Soul Tool Hall’s work with Ju Zi, Xuan Ziwen, Lou Gao, and Mu Chen pushes its Battle Armor forging toward Spirit-Forged Metal. The auction of Thousand-Forged Tungsten Steel elevates the pavilion’s industrial profile and attracts blacksmith talent from across the continent. 339 344 355
